If you believe that each of us has a soul, you might be interested in the concept that souls can become "lost," or at least fragmented in a way that leaves one feeling incomplete, often due to trauma.A spiritual practice called "soul retrieval" aims to bring back those lost parts of ourselves. Here's how it works, plus signs you might be in need of soul healing.
In soul retrieval, a person is typically guided by an experienced shaman through the process of bringing the lost soul back. The shaman will reach an altered state of consciousness, go into the
unseen realms of spirit, find the soul, and then begin to address whatever it is that caused the soul to fragment. From there, they'll bring the soul back into this plane.
Soul loss can be defined as a type of fragmentation that can occur after some type of trauma. Psychologically, it can be explained as dissociation, but it's a way we learn to survive traumatic events this can happen at any time and can also build up gradually.
When we become burnt out (physically, mentally, emotionally, and/or spiritually), have strayed from our purpose, or experience something traumatizing, any of these things can cause the soul to "disconnect."
